Germany, SS. A Waffen-SS Cap Eagle, Ground-Dug Example, by Ferdinand Wagner Archive Monaco 1922-49(Waffen SS Mtzenadler). Constructed of silvered zink, the obverse consisting of a second pattern SS style german national eagle clutching a wreathed mobile swastika, the reverse retaining two of three original attachment prongs, marked with a Reichszeugmeisterei (RZM) logo and maker code 475 42 for Ferdinand Wagner, Pforzheim, measuring 68 mm (w) x 30 mm (h), demonstrating total loss of finish throughout, in addition to surface oxidation, bending, and
